Transaction 3cdc431a59282e241b9142480e761083033de919e9165b8758af24e60ef329d5
1 Input
1 Output
-
3cdc431a59282e241b9142480e761083033de919e9165b8758af24e60ef329d5:0
- value
- 6545091
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 40b1c350853f6c47782dbbcf66d66c2bdba3670eddd440fb15127a7b6d2c5d83
- address
- bc1pgzcux5y98akyw7pdh08kd4nv90d6xecwmh2yp7c4zfa8kmfvtkpsq7s4kx